You can try online png to webp converter. Websites such as Convetio provide online conversion functions. You just need to upload the PNG file, select the output format as WebP, click Convert, and download it. This method is especially suitable for people who don't want to install software.
Using online png to webp converters is indeed convenient, but there are also some disadvantages.
- First, when uploading large files or batches of files, you may be subject to file size and number restrictions, which makes it not suitable for large-scale conversion.
- Second, it relies on network connection. If the network is unstable, the conversion process may be affected. In addition, for privacy and security reasons, uploading files to third-party websites may be worrying, especially when sensitive content is involved.
